Ironic the way this is panning out. One of the justisfications for this change was to prevent or get rid of the drift towards the Police being politicised. Nearly all the candidates in the North East so far appear to be nominated from the political parties.
To Not4Me ....I could not agree more. Over the last few months I have banged the drum for long enough about this very same point. I have posted several times on this site regarding the political overtures made by the likes of Mr.Pottinger who is on record as saying"It is vital that Labour secure this position" I ask the question why is it so politically vital? What is in his mind? It is inevitable that to some degree the Police Service/Force or what ever have to answer to their paymasters however that is totally different from being dominated by a political party.Rank and file officers are prohibited by law from being party members in any event but that fact seems to be forgotten. This is another ill thoughout change by government that will end in tears.
